Evidence of dissipative solitons in Yb3+:CaYAlO4 |
Optics Express, Vol. 19, Issue 19, pp. 18495-18500 (2011)
http://dx.doi.org/10.1364/OE.19.018495
Acrobat PDF (876 KB)
Abstract
Operation of an end-pumped Yb3+: CaYAlO4 laser operating in the positive dispersion regime is experimentally investigated. The laser emitted strongly chirped pulses with extremely steep spectral edges, resembling the characteristics of dissipative solitons observed in fiber lasers. The results show that dissipative soliton emission constitutes another operating regime for mode locked Yb3+-doped solid state lasers, which can be explored for the generation of stable large energy femtosecond pulses.
